Manchester United 'closing in on Hakan Calhanoglu deal'

Hakan Calhanoglu celebrates scoring for Milan on September 24, 2020© Reuters

Manchester United are closing in on a future deal for AC Milan playmaker Hakan Calhanoglu, according to transfer expert Christian Falk.

The Turkey international has been linked with a move to Old Trafford for several weeks following his strong performances for the Rossoneri, where he boasts four goals and four assists in the current campaign.

Arsenal and Atletico Madrid have also been linked with a swoop for the 26-year-old, but Falk has claimed that negotiations between Calhanoglu and United are already at an advanced stage and a move to Manchester is edging ever closer.

Speaking to the Stretford Paddock Podcast, Falk said: "It's true and I think this will happen because last summer there will already talks with his agent. I don't know if you know but Juventus would have also have liked him last summer but he said 'no'.

"He said no because he already knew what would happen this summer with United. Talks are already very, very far at the moment and he'll be a free agent, so this transfer is very, very likely.

"He can be a good player if everything around him is working, then he can help United. He's not the kind of player that if something went wrong he'd say 'now we have to fight'.

"He's a technical player, perhaps it is Pogba to show him the way. Then I feel like he could do it at United."

Calhanoglu is currently in the final year of his contract with Milan, although the Italian giants are supposedly attempting to tie him down to a new deal.



Real Madrid 'passed up chance to sign Bruno Fernandes'

Bruno Fernandes celebrates scoring for Manchester United against Istanbul Basaksehir in the Champions League on November 24, 2020© Reuters

Real Madrid were reportedly interested in signing Bruno Fernandes before the attacker joined Manchester United from Sporting Lisbon.

The Portugal international moved to Old Trafford in January and has been in excellent form for the Red Devils, scoring 21 times and contributing 13 assists in 35 appearances in all competitions.

Fernandes has already struck nine goals in 13 outings at club level this term, meanwhile, including a brace against Istanbul Basaksehir in the Champions League on Tuesday night.

According to Marca, Madrid considered moving for the 26-year-old earlier this year but were instead distracted by other possible targets, including Paul Pogba.

The report claims that Los Blancos could have afforded to sign the Portuguese in January but passed up the opportunity despite being admirers of his talents.

Fernandes has a contract with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's side until June 2025.
